Biban El Moluk, or The Valley of the Kings situated on the ancient site of Thebes. It is a place where the pharaoh’s were hoped and buried in the afterlife to meet their Gods. Here, you will find Tutankhamun’s tomb which in the 1920′s was discovered almost intact. You can go inside the tomb, but to see the treasures he was buried with, you’ll have to visit the Egyptian Museum in Cairo. In the scheme of things, actually Tutankhamun was quite a minor king and there are more impressive and many larger tombs to discover in the Valley of the Kings.

For visiting the tombs there are few tips:

- Better if explore the tombs in the winter months, about November-March
- You can get into 3 tombs with A ticket, which is probably enough for a day
- Just make sure you are wear good walking shoes and fit.
